Wall surface camping tents commonly come with a complete floor or a 3/4 flooring with cooktop floor covering, which leaves the front 1/4 of the tent area bare for safe use of a wood burning stove. These floors are available as either sewn-in or tying systems.

Tarps
Numerous outfitters and hunters select to utilize tarpaulins for their wall surface camping tent floorings. Not only are they affordable, yet they likewise maintain wetness and critters out.
They're likewise highly sturdy and lightweight, that makes them simple to lug and set up. They're woven with an alloy of light weight aluminum and other products to withstand abrasions. Tarps are categorized as light, tool, or strong.
Some brand names use a range of dimensions to fit the floor area of each of their models. For example, Beckel Canvas supplies separated floor tarps made of 14 oz. plastic that are specifically designed to fit each of their wall surface tents, complete with grommets around the sides for connecting them down tight.
